This week’s Phenomenal Asian is Vivian Yau, Founder of Bee Influence, an influencer marketing agency based in Manchester. Viv and I actually met through instagram as she launched her own podcast ‘But where are you from?’, around the same time as I did. The more we spoke, the more we realised how similar are lives were; both take away kids, both started our own company, both the same age but we also both lost a parent from cancer. Although we had never met, it was incredible how well we hit it off and how honest we were able to be so quickly. I really hope you enjoy this episode and do let us know what you think.

This week’s Phenomenal Asian is Nigel Ng, a stand-up comedian originally from Malaysia and co-host of the hugely popular 'Rice To Meet You', one of the first comedy podcasts about Asian culture. Given the severe lack of Asian representation in UK comedy, I was super excited to have Nigel as a guest as he's been making waves on the comedy scene and was nominated for the prestigious Best Newcomer Award for his sold-out show Culture Shocked at the Edinburgh Fringe Festival last year. I hope you enjoy this episode as much as I did and prove to you that Asians can be pretty funny too.

This week’s phenomenal asian or shall I say asians are my brothers Wayne & Gwan Yip. I’m so lucky to be close with my family and especially my brothers, as we all live in different cities around the world. I really enjoyed this episode as it’s a conversation our family has never had before and it was fascinating to hear how different our childhoods were even though we were raised the same.
Being the youngest of 3, my brothers are are my ‘asian’ role models, Wayne is a successful Director, on TV shows such as Misfits, Utopia, Dr Who and Gwan founded his own company Core 3D, a software company based in NY. I’m super proud of them and what they’ve achieved that I hope collectively we are redefining the asian stereotype as a family.

This week’s guest is Foong Ng, Founder of Matchable, a platform offering employees game-changing opportunities to work with not-for-profits and startups on innovative projects. We chat about the difficult switch Foong made from a PwC Tax Director to female entrepreneur and the guilt that comes with it, especially telling your Asian parents. Foong and I actually share very similar stories, I used to work for PwC too and set up my own company almost 5 years ago but I've always wondered, if more Asians could hear inspiring stories like Foong's, would we have more confidence in making our own career choices vs simply pleasing our parents?

This week’s guest is Arnold Ma, Founder of Qumin, an award-winning Chinese digital creative agency. It felt like Arnold and I had known each other for years! We bonded over many things, how we dealt with being the only Asian kids at school, how we hated being different and our love for Dragon Ball Z of course. What I really admired most was his effort in reconnecting with his Asian roots and how embracing his ethnicity has led Arnold to create a successful business.

This week’s guest is Shu Shi Lin or you might know her as Dejashu, a Food, Travel and Lifestyle Vlogger (yes, she gets paid to eat and travel the world). Shu and I chat about life growing up in the UK, about her parents owning a Chinese takeaway (because mine did too) and how she wants to use her platform to stand up to the racism escalating from Coronavirus.
